Q: Board told all the owners I have caused the HOA to pay $10,000 in attorney fees. It’s a lie

We petitioned to remove Pres., Mang Agent & Pres. spent almost $3,000 for attorney to handle the meeting and said it’s because of me. I haven’t hired an attorney for anything to make them. What can I do to let owners know it’s not true? Owners are angry with me, we have less than $10,000 in checking. I do have all legal invoices as proof.

A: If the attorney invoices aren’t subject to a protective order or confidentiality agreement, send copies to all of the homeowners in the HOA so they know the truth.
